Latest Patents
Thomas Urbitsch holds a patent for an "Electronic system for driving light sources and method of driving light sources." This system includes lighting devices connected to output supply pins, a microcontroller circuit, and a driver circuit. The driver circuit receives data from the microcontroller and controls the lighting devices by selectively propagating a supply voltage to provide pulse-width modulated supply signals. The microcontroller is capable of individually adjusting the brightness of the lighting devices, allowing for greater control and efficiency.
